My FQDN certificate has been auto-renewed GoDaddy. According to https://www.3cx.com/docs/self-hosted-instances-ssh/ I need to replace the .pem files and restart the NGINX service.

I downloaded the cert from GoDaddy using "Other" server type however I only see the standard .crt files. How do I generate the .pem files to replace the current files?

Seems there is another step involved that I'm missing.

Hello @uptown1

You will either need to re-install the system by performing a backup without licence and FQDN. Then save the backup to a non 3CX location. Un-install the system and re-install using the backup and the new certificate or convert your .pem certificate using open ssl and use the output of that to replace the current certificates
